Replacement Backlights
http://backlights.telesisgear.com/
http://www.midi-rakete.de/eng/elfolie.htm (they have instructions with pics on how to change them, very good quality foils)
http://www.backlights.co.uk (I didn't like the quality from them, but it was only one so it could have been a fluke)
You can order a backlight in different colors, Forat will modify a 3000 backlight which turns the display yellow, which is supposed to be very clear, but I have never seen a pic so I can't vouch for that. Most people go with blue or green, but there is a white backlight which is what I use, it's very clear to read, but the color is more of a light blue than white.
You can see pictures of both blue and white backlights close up in the MPC60 Yahoo Group photos section.
